Endpoint security is the discipline of protecting the devices people actually use to work — laptops, desktops, mobile phones, tablets, and the identities tied to them — from compromise by malware, ransomware, phishing, and credential theft. For South African businesses, endpoint security is the most cost-effective layer of cyber defence available: most breaches start at the endpoint, and modern endpoint protection (specifically EDR — Endpoint Detection and Response) catches 80–90% of threats that legacy antivirus misses.

What is endpoint security?

Endpoint security is the practice of protecting the devices that connect to your network — laptops, desktops, servers, phones, tablets — from malware, ransomware, phishing, and credential theft.

Modern endpoint security uses Endpoint Detection and Response (EDR) technology that monitors device behaviour for signs of compromise, rather than the signature-matching approach of legacy antivirus.

For South African SMEs, managed endpoint security has become the practical baseline because the skills to operate EDR effectively are scarce and expensive.

What's the difference between antivirus and EDR?

Antivirus compares files against a database of known malware signatures — effective against threats seen before, blind to anything new.

EDR monitors device behaviour: what processes are running, what they're doing, what they're connecting to. Behaviour-based detection catches fileless attacks, ransomware staging, credential theft, and zero-day exploits that signature-based AV can't see.

Most modern endpoint security products (SentinelOne, Microsoft Defender for Endpoint, CrowdStrike) are EDR with antivirus included.

Does Wired Protect support BYOD?

Yes, with appropriate scoping. Personal devices accessing business data via Microsoft 365 or Google Workspace can be protected through Microsoft Intune mobile application management or Google Workspace mobile management — protecting the business data without taking control of the user's personal device.

Fully managed BYOD (where the user's personal laptop is enrolled in EDR) is supported with explicit user consent.
